
Hyenas are famous for their habit of swooping in to steal the hard-earned kills of other predators. This is not a reputation which they’ve won unfairly, and this footage from Nkorho Bush Lodge shows just how relentless they can be.
Karin van der Merwe caught this fierce battle on camera, and sent it in to Latest Sightings. The lone lion had made a kill that lay almost completely hidden in the tall grass, and this clan of hungry hyenas wanted a taste of it.

Stealing kills is a valid feeding tactic that lions will also engage in if they have the opportunity. For animals with clan, pack or pride social structures, overwhelming lone competitors can guarantee an easy meal.
Against The Mob
Spotted hyena clans can reach surprisingly high numbers of individuals, with some of them reaching over seventy, or even a hundred hyenas. Luckily for the lion, these clans do not typically roam in such high numbers.

Hyenas will hunt in smaller groups, although for this lion, small is relative. Despite her larger size and greater strength, this lioness was facing overwhelming odds, and what’s even more impressive was that she was standing her ground.
The lioness’s kill was stashed beneath a large bush, which gave it some protection, but the hyenas were absolutely determined to either intimidate or irritate the lion into leaving it undefended.
Outnumbered And Outflanked
With the amount of hyenas running in circles around the bush, like a predatory natural tornado, they could pose enough of a threat that the lion had to act.

While the lion was chasing one hyena away, another could have a go at trying to steal the kill. The hyenas were organised, and they were quick, but this lioness knew their game.
Area Defense
Although she did take risks by directly charging and attacking hyenas that she picked out from the crowd, the lioness was always quick to return to her kill.

The hyenas may have outnumbered her, but she could fight off two or even three at once, and still make it back to the bush before any of her opponents could make off with her meal.
Time was running out for the hyenas, in-between their assaults the lioness appeared to be taking the time to consume small amounts of her kill, meaning they had to try and steal it before she could eat too much.

Surrounded By Thieves
The hyenas had almost everything going their way. They had surrounded the lioness, and they only needed a few seconds to snatch their competitor’s kill, but despite their best efforts they couldn’t pull it off.
They hadn’t factored in the ferocity of the lioness that bravely managed to keep them at bay while it fed. This was truly an amazing display of strength and ferocity from the lion.

Exactly how long the lioness was able to defend her kill for is unknown, but by the time Karin stopped filming it looked like the hyenas had finally given up with hassling the lion.
